Ivan Enchev-Vidyu Bulgarian Folk Crosses 15, 25 April 1917

15. Cross - tombstone, in the old cemeteries of the town. Scrap. Four-winged. The upper and lower wings are longer; all are quartered; the upper one ends with two apples, the side ones with one each. On his face is engraved a four-winged cross with a stand; a line is engraved around the end contour, and around the waist —. It was carved before the russo-turkish war from gray whetstone. Dimensions: 35x33x10 cm. Sketched on 25. Iv. 1917. (t. B, obr. 2. ). Date: 25 April 1917.
